Ms. Linda Carol Cummins, age 58, of Madison, Indiana, entered this life on September 19, 1951 in Valparaiso, Indiana. She was the daughter of Raymond & Liberty N. Kubick Cummins. She was raised in Union Mills & Westville, Indiana. She was a 1969, graduate of Westville High School. She resided for several years in Elk Grove near Chicago. She moved to Madison in 1996 and became very involved in the community. Linda was employed with Star Quality Awards in Madison since 1996. Her customers appreciated her attention to detail and the fine work she displayed in their orders. She also worked at J.C. Penney's in the catalog department for twelve years. She was a faithful member of the Faith Lutheran Church in Madison, where she was very active and served as vice president of the Lutheran Women's Missionary League & Guild. Linda chaired the Board of Evangelism at Faith Lutheran and served as Secretary of the Church Council. She also spearheaded the Angel Tree Project of the Church as well. Linda enjoyed taking care of the crafts and remembrances in the Church. Linda was diagnosed with pancreatic cancer on Dec. 20, 2009 and fought a courageous battle against the disease. Linda will be greatly missed by her loving family, her church family and her many friends in the community. Linda died Friday, January 29, 2010 at 3:10 p.m. at the King's Daughters' Hospital in Madison, Indiana.
